MAC环境变量设置

打印 上一主题 下一主题

主题 1018|帖子 1018|积分 3054

 前言

本帖子是作者在使用mac电脑中设置环境变量所碰到的坑,作为新人,总结得可能不太到位,请各位大佬看到了勿喷。

设置mac环境变量有三种方法,详情可见下图。(操作方法没有细讲,但是有windows设置环境变量的朋友们应该都能看懂)

1. export命令

export命令能直接查看本机所有的环境变量设置。


export value_name = value 可创建临时的环境变量,仅在本终端收效

例子:设置anaconda环境,值得注意的是,在设置背面需要添加: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in,该路径是初始路径,假如没有,则`ls`那些命令也无法使用,由于新的环境变量会覆盖旧的环境变量

Plain Text
export PATH = /Users/yanghuisenmac/anaconda3/bin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in

使用 unset value_name 移除,注意是永久移除

2.~/.bash_profile

该文件中可以设置 用户级别 的环境变量,该文件是位于你的用户目录下,默认隐藏起来的。

使用以下命令打开.bash_profile文件,即可在末了添加你所需要的环境变量的路径。


Plain Text
open ~/.bash_profile


编译.bash_profile文件

Plain Text
source ~/.bash_profile

3./etc/bashrc 与 /etc/profile

这两个文件是界说体系级别 的环境变量,不建议修改,可以简朴的看一下。


文末

环境变量的执行序次可以参考https://blog.csdn.net/z040145/article/details/129366568,该文章陈诉了linux体系环境变量设置文件的执行序次,可以参考。

在mac中设置环境变量的好像是这三种办法。与linux体系相比,减少了好几设置环境变量的途径。

提供一个小思绪,由于macOS是基于Unix体系开辟的,许多命令或者问题与linux体系雷同,假如直接搜刮mac问题时不能直接搜出来,可以把mac关键词转为linux。


参考文章:

https://zhuanlan.zhihu.com/p/651995927?utm_id=0

https://blog.csdn.net/z040145/article/details/129366568

http://www.mobiletrain.org/about/BBS/127780.html



免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

x
回复

使用道具 举报

0 个回复

倒序浏览

快速回复

您需要登录后才可以回帖 登录 or 立即注册

本版积分规则

没腿的鸟

论坛元老
这个人很懒什么都没写!
快速回复 返回顶部 返回列表